Output d358f70612a6fdadb4aec12437301ad3fd260f951a56d0a5a036ae1883cbe31c:12

value
2811300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86df6effd5e8e12f37411ac06ff1dc24aee8f7ca OP_EQUAL
address
3DzA8gohHpC6aHpG1QWdzgkYAHSk3K9bjf
transaction
d358f70612a6fdadb4aec12437301ad3fd260f951a56d0a5a036ae1883cbe31c
spent
true